The most popular Heroes® title of all time is back in HD! Fifteen years later, rediscover the epic tale of Queen Catherine Ironfist, as she re-embarks on her critically acclaimed quest to unite her ravaged homeland and re-conquer the kingdom of Erathia.

Pros
- Classic and deep turn-based strategy gameplay
- Hd graphics update with option to switch to original
- Engaging fantasy setting and music
- Map editor and mod support
- Multiplayer and achievements support
Cons
- Missing expansions and random map generator
- Some bugs and ui issues
- High price for base game only
- Multiplayer community is small
- Lack of quality of life improvements compared to mods
